Transaction 3d07714a91eeef342cebd9e250d10d02b77edb181089750cc0a18d78198cdd8d
1 Input
1 Output
-
3d07714a91eeef342cebd9e250d10d02b77edb181089750cc0a18d78198cdd8d:0
- value
- 1470895
- script pubkey
- OP_0 OP_PUSHBYTES_20 88db4fb0f46f11830a5446c64a52055405ccf878
- address
- bc1q3rd5lv85dugcxzj5gmry55s92szue7rcdk0h0n